My reasoning behind logging IRC would be to provide a place where  
finding information about bugs, features, websites, etc on the  
channel. If someone wanted to look up more information on a  
particular subject they could simply click on the log and go to any  
particular spot on the wiki or the web to obtain more information.  
What if someone wasn't able to use IRC because they were at work, or  
blocked because of parental controls, etc? Providing a log would  
allow a person to find out what is happening. Just a thought.
